2024 Chevy Traverse vs 2024 Kia Sorento Seats and interior space
The Traverse is slightly larger than the Sorento, allowing for more legroom and luggage space in the third row. The Traverse has 18.7 cubic feet of luggage space when the Sorento’s rear seats are folded down, compared to the Sorento’s 12.6 cubic feet. The Traverse has more storage space with a larger center console and more door pockets.
2024 Chevy Traverse vs 2024 Kia Sorento Engine and Performance
The Traverse is powered by a 3.6-liter V6 engine, which produces 310 horsepower and 260 lb-ft of torque. The Sorento is powered by a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ine that produces 281 horsepower and 311 lb-ft of torque. The Traverse has an eight-speed automatic transmission, while the Sorento has an eight-speed dual-clutch automatic.
The Traverse is quicker than the Sorento, accelerating from 0 to 60 mph in 7.3 seconds, compared to the Sorento’s 7.8 seconds. The Traverse’s towing capacity is also higher, at 5,000 pounds, compared to the Sorento’s 3,500 pounds.
2024 Chevy Traverse vs 2024 Kia Sorento Fuel economy
Traverse is less fuel efficient than Sorento. According to EPA estimates, the Traverse gets 18 mpg in the city and 26 mpg on the highway. The Sorento gets 24 mpg in the city and 29 mpg on the highway.
